Mangalore : Vibrant sketches stole the show at the fourth edition of Kudla Kala Mela, a two-day art expo with a difference which kick-started near the Kadri Park in Mangalore on December 14, Saturday. MCC Commissioner Ajith Kumar Hegde inaugurated the Kala Mela jointly organised by the Karavali Chitrakala Chavadi, Karnataka Lalitha Kala Academy and Department of Kannada and Culture.
In his address, Ajith Kumar Hegde said such exhibitions go a long way in encouraging youngsters in the field of art. He said art works provide solace to stressed minds and appreciated the organisers for the great event.
The art stalls put up on either side of Kadri Park Road were declared open by Roopa D Bangera, local corporator. K Sudhindra, Registrar of Karnataka Lalitha Kala Academy, Harikrishna Punaroor, former president of Kannada Sahitya Parishat, Vishnu Shiva Guru, President of Karavali Chitrakala Chavadi, Koti Prasad Alva, Honorary Advisor and others were present.
Tributes were also to Jagadish Ammunje, a well known artiste who breathed his last recently.
